    GlossaryEpidermal Keratins

    proteins that strengthen skin, hair, and nails

    Epidermal keratins are a type of protein found in the outer layer of the skin, known as the epidermis. They help provide structural strength and protection to the skin, hair, and nails. These proteins are essential for maintaining the integrity and resilience of the skin, making it resistant to physical stress and environmental damage.
